//! Implementation of the install aspects of the compiler.
//!
//! This module is responsible for installing the standard library,
//! compiler, and documentation.
use std::env;
use std::fs;
use std::path::{Component, PathBuf};
use std::process::Command;
use build_helper::t;
use crate::dist::{self, sanitize_sh};
use crate::tarball::GeneratedTarball;
use crate::Compiler;
use crate::builder::{Builder, RunConfig, ShouldRun, Step};
use crate::config::{Config, TargetSelection};
fn install_sh(
builder: &Builder<'_>,
package: &str,
stage: u32,
host: Option<TargetSelection>,
tarball: &GeneratedTarball,
) {
builder.info(&format!("Install {} stage{} ({:?})", package, stage, host));
let prefix = default_path(&builder.config.prefix, "/usr/local");
let sysconfdir = prefix.join(default_path(&builder.config.sysconfdir, "/etc"));
let datadir = prefix.join(default_path(&builder.config.datadir, "share"));
let docdir = prefix.join(default_path(&builder.config.docdir, "share/doc/rust"));
let mandir = prefix.join(default_path(&builder.config.mandir, "share/man"));
let libdir = prefix.join(default_path(&builder.config.libdir, "lib"));
let bindir = prefix.join(&builder.config.bindir); // Default in config.rs
let empty_dir = builder.out.join("tmp/empty_dir");
t!(fs::create_dir_all(&empty_dir));
let mut cmd = Command::new("sh");
cmd.current_dir(&empty_dir)
.arg(sanitize_sh(&tarball.decompressed_output().join("install.sh")))
.arg(format!("--prefix={}", prepare_dir(prefix)))
.arg(format!("--sysconfdir={}", prepare_dir(sysconfdir)))
.arg(format!("--datadir={}", prepare_dir(datadir)))
.arg(format!("--docdir={}", prepare_dir(docdir)))
.arg(format!("--bindir={}", prepare_dir(bindir)))
.arg(format!("--libdir={}", prepare_dir(libdir)))
.arg(format!("--mandir={}", prepare_dir(mandir)))
.arg("--disable-ldconfig");
builder.run(&mut cmd);
t!(fs::remove_dir_all(&empty_dir));
}
fn default_path(config: &Option<PathBuf>, default: &str) -> PathBuf {
config.as_ref().cloned().unwrap_or_else(|| PathBuf::from(default))
}
fn prepare_dir(mut path: PathBuf) -> String {
// The DESTDIR environment variable is a standard way to install software in a subdirectory
// while keeping the original directory structure, even if the prefix or other directories
// contain absolute paths.
//
// More information on the environment variable is available here:
// https://www.gnu.org/prep/standards/html_node/DESTDIR.html
if let Some(destdir) = env::var_os("DESTDIR").map(PathBuf::from) {
let without_destdir = path.clone();
path = destdir;
// Custom .join() which ignores disk roots.
for part in without_destdir.components() {
if let Component::Normal(s) = part {
path.push(s)
}
}
}
// The installation command is not executed from the current directory, but from a temporary
// directory. To prevent relative paths from breaking this converts relative paths to absolute
// paths. std::fs::canonicalize is not used as that requires the path to actually be present.
if path.is_relative() {
path = std::env::current_dir().expect("failed to get the current directory").join(path);
assert!(path.is_absolute(), "could not make the path relative");
}
sanitize_sh(&path)
}
macro_rules! install {
(($sel:ident, $builder:ident, $_config:ident),
$($name:ident,
$path:expr,
$default_cond:expr,
only_hosts: $only_hosts:expr,
$run_item:block $(, $c:ident)*;)+) => {
$(
#[derive(Debug, Copy, Clone, Hash, PartialEq, Eq)]
pub struct $name {
pub compiler: Compiler,
pub target: TargetSelection,
}
impl $name {
#[allow(dead_code)]
fn should_build(config: &Config) -> bool {
config.extended && config.tools.as_ref()
.map_or(true, |t| t.contains($path))
}
}
impl Step for $name {
type Output = ();
const DEFAULT: bool = true;
const ONLY_HOSTS: bool = $only_hosts;
$(const $c: bool = true;)*
fn should_run(run: ShouldRun<'_>) -> ShouldRun<'_> {
let $_config = &run.builder.config;
run.path($path).default_condition($default_cond)
}
fn make_run(run: RunConfig<'_>) {
run.builder.ensure($name {
compiler: run.builder.compiler(run.builder.top_stage, run.builder.config.build),
target: run.target,
});
}
fn run($sel, $builder: &Builder<'_>) {
$run_item
}
})+
}
}
install!((self, builder, _config),
Docs, "src/doc", _config.docs, only_hosts: false, {
let tarball = builder.ensure(dist::Docs { host: self.target }).expect("missing docs");
install_sh(builder, "docs", self.compiler.stage, Some(self.target), &tarball);
};
Std, "library/std", true, only_hosts: false, {
for target in &builder.targets {
let tarball = builder.ensure(dist::Std {
compiler: self.compiler,
target: *target
}).expect("missing std");
install_sh(builder, "std", self.compiler.stage, Some(*target), &tarball);
}
};
Cargo, "cargo", Self::should_build(_config), only_hosts: true, {
let tarball = builder.ensure(dist::Cargo { compiler: self.compiler, target: self.target });
install_sh(builder, "cargo", self.compiler.stage, Some(self.target), &tarball);
};
Rls, "rls", Self::should_build(_config), only_hosts: true, {
if let Some(tarball) = builder.ensure(dist::Rls { compiler: self.compiler, target: self.target }) {
install_sh(builder, "rls", self.compiler.stage, Some(self.target), &tarball);
} else {
builder.info(
&format!("skipping Install RLS stage{} ({})", self.compiler.stage, self.target),
);
}
};
RustAnalyzer, "rust-analyzer", Self::should_build(_config), only_hosts: true, {
let tarball = builder
.ensure(dist::RustAnalyzer { compiler: self.compiler, target: self.target })
.expect("missing rust-analyzer");
install_sh(builder, "rust-analyzer", self.compiler.stage, Some(self.target), &tarball);
};
Clippy, "clippy", Self::should_build(_config), only_hosts: true, {
let tarball = builder.ensure(dist::Clippy { compiler: self.compiler, target: self.target });
install_sh(builder, "clippy", self.compiler.stage, Some(self.target), &tarball);
};
Miri, "miri", Self::should_build(_config), only_hosts: true, {
if let Some(tarball) = builder.ensure(dist::Miri { compiler: self.compiler, target: self.target }) {
install_sh(builder, "miri", self.compiler.stage, Some(self.target), &tarball);
} else {
builder.info(
&format!("skipping Install miri stage{} ({})", self.compiler.stage, self.target),
);
}
};
Rustfmt, "rustfmt", Self::should_build(_config), only_hosts: true, {
if let Some(tarball) = builder.ensure(dist::Rustfmt {
compiler: self.compiler,
target: self.target
}) {
install_sh(builder, "rustfmt", self.compiler.stage, Some(self.target), &tarball);
} else {
builder.info(
&format!("skipping Install Rustfmt stage{} ({})", self.compiler.stage, self.target),
);
}
};
Analysis, "analysis", Self::should_build(_config), only_hosts: false, {
let tarball = builder.ensure(dist::Analysis {
// Find the actual compiler (handling the full bootstrap option) which
// produced the save-analysis data because that data isn't copied
// through the sysroot uplifting.
compiler: builder.compiler_for(builder.top_stage, builder.config.build, self.target),
target: self.target
}).expect("missing analysis");
install_sh(builder, "analysis", self.compiler.stage, Some(self.target), &tarball);
};
Rustc, "src/librustc", true, only_hosts: true, {
let tarball = builder.ensure(dist::Rustc {
compiler: builder.compiler(builder.top_stage, self.target),
});
install_sh(builder, "rustc", self.compiler.stage, Some(self.target), &tarball);
};
);
#[derive(Debug, Copy, Clone, Hash, PartialEq, Eq)]
pub struct Src {
pub stage: u32,
}
impl Step for Src {
type Output = ();
const DEFAULT: bool = true;
const ONLY_HOSTS: bool = true;
fn should_run(run: ShouldRun<'_>) -> ShouldRun<'_> {
let config = &run.builder.config;
let cond = config.extended && config.tools.as_ref().map_or(true, |t| t.contains("src"));
run.path("src").default_condition(cond)
}
fn make_run(run: RunConfig<'_>) {
run.builder.ensure(Src { stage: run.builder.top_stage });
}
fn run(self, builder: &Builder<'_>) {
let tarball = builder.ensure(dist::Src);
install_sh(builder, "src", self.stage, None, &tarball);
}
}
